HP Vectra vl800 review

Processor
Processor manufacturer: Intel
Processor model: Pentium 4
Clock speed: 1.5 GHz
Motherboard
Motherboard: Intel/HP OEM
Processor socket: Socket 423
Chipset: Intel 850
Data bus speed: 400 MHz
Memory
RAM installed: 256 MB
RAM capacity: 1.024 GB
Memory specification compliance: PC800
Interfaces & networking
Serial: 2
Parallel: 1
Expansion slots (free): 5 (4)
Hard drive storage
Hard drive interface type: Ultra ATA/100
Hard drive size: 40.9 GB
Rotation speed: 7200 rpm
Storage controller: Intel Ultra ATA/100
Video
Graphics processor: nVidia GeForce2 GTS
Graphics RAM: 32 MB
Graphics card: nVidia GeForce2 GTS
Display
Display technology: TFT
Display diagonal size: 15 in
Cabinet (chassis)
Case form factor: desktop
Tool-free access: yes
Front-accessible bays: 1
Internal bays: 1
Audio
Speakers: none
OS & software
Operating system: Windows 2000 Professional
Software included: HP e-DiagTools, HP TopTools 5.0
Service & support
Standard warranty: 3 years, next business day on-site
Miscellaneous
Other: Windows NT 4.0 supported; Linux certified

Overview

HP Vectra vl800

Editors rating
Rating: 7.5
Verdict

A good first cut at a Pentium 4 system for business use, even if the CPU has yet to prove its worth.

Typical price

£ 2057
